在现代远程办公和跨地域网络访问日益普及的背景下,虚拟私人网络(VPN)已成为企业与个人用户保障数据安全传输的重要工具,L2TP(Layer 2 Tunneling Protocol)是一种广泛支持的协议,尤其在Windows操作系统中内置了原生L2TP/IPSec客户端,使得配置和使用变得相对便捷,本文将详细介绍如何在Windows系统上正确配置L2TP VPN,并提供常见问题的排查方法,帮助网络工程师快速定位并解决问题。

配置L2TP VPN的前提是确保服务器端已正确部署并启用L2TP/IPSec服务,这需要一个运行Windows Server的服务器或第三方设备(如Cisco、华为等),并配置好IPSec预共享密钥(PSK)、用户认证方式(如RADIUS)以及分配的IP地址池,一旦服务器环境准备就绪,即可在Windows客户端进行连接设置。

具体步骤如下:

  1. 打开“控制面板” → “网络和共享中心” → “设置新连接或网络”;
  2. 选择“连接到工作区”,点击“下一步”;
  3. 输入服务器地址(如vpn.example.com 或公网IP);
  4. 选择“使用我的Internet连接(VPN)”;
  5. 设置连接名称(公司L2TP VPN”),点击“创建”;
  6. 双击该连接,进入属性界面,在“选项”标签页中勾选“加密数据(不安全的连接可能被阻止)”;
  7. 在“安全”标签页中,选择“第二层隧道协议(L2TP/IPSec)”,并在“数据加密”中选择“要求加密(仅允许加密的连接)”;
  8. 最关键一步:在“高级设置”中,点击“设置”按钮,输入预共享密钥(PSK),必须与服务器端一致;
  9. 点击“确定”后,输入用户名和密码,尝试连接。

若连接失败,常见原因包括:

  • 预共享密钥不匹配:这是最常见的错误,请务必确认客户端和服务端使用的PSK完全一致(区分大小写);
  • 防火墙阻断UDP端口:L2TP依赖UDP 1701端口,IPSec则需UDP 500和ESP协议(协议号50),建议检查本地防火墙及ISP是否屏蔽这些端口;
  • 时间不同步:Windows对时间同步敏感,若客户端与服务器时间相差超过5分钟,IPSec协商会失败;
  • DNS解析异常:若使用域名连接,请确保客户端能正常解析服务器地址;
  • 用户权限不足:某些企业环境要求特定组策略或证书才能建立连接,需联系IT管理员。

可借助Windows自带的“事件查看器”(Event Viewer)查看“系统日志”中的“Microsoft-Windows-NetworkProfile/Operational”条目,获取详细错误代码(如错误0x80072746表示证书无效,0x800704CD为连接超时),从而精准定位问题。

Windows L2TP VPN虽然配置简单,但细节决定成败,网络工程师应熟练掌握其底层原理(L2TP负责封装,IPSec负责加密),并善于利用系统日志和网络抓包工具(如Wireshark)辅助诊断,通过规范配置与持续监控,可以构建稳定、安全的远程接入通道,满足企业多样化的网络需求。

Windows系统下L2TP VPN配置与故障排查详解  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N